DeepSeek
DeepSeek-R1-Zero was introduced as an experimental variant trained with minimal human supervision, designed to develop reasoning patterns through self-guided reinforcement learning. Built to explore how models can discover analytical strategies independently, it represents research into autonomous reasoning capability development.
NVIDIA
Llama 3.1 Nemotron Ultra 253B was developed as NVIDIA's largest Nemotron variant, designed to provide maximum capability through extensive customization of large-scale foundations. Built with 253 billion parameters and NVIDIA's specialized training, it represents the flagship offering in the Nemotron family.
